技术文摘
在JavaScript中如何将第二个字符串连接到第一个字符串的末尾
在JavaScript中如何将第二个字符串连接到第一个字符串的末尾
在JavaScript编程中,将一个字符串连接到另一个字符串的末尾是一项常见的操作。这一功能在很多场景下都十分实用,比如处理用户输入、构建动态文本内容等。下面就为大家详细介绍几种实现该功能的方法。
最基本的方式就是使用加号(+)运算符。在JavaScript里,加号运算符不仅能用于数字运算,还能进行字符串拼接。例如,有两个字符串变量str1和str2,我们想把str2连接到str1的末尾,只需使用简单的表达式:str1 = str1 + str2 。这种方法简洁明了,易于理解和使用,适合初学者。比如:
let str1 = "Hello, ";
let str2 = "world!";
str1 = str1 + str2;
console.log(str1);
运行这段代码,控制台将输出 “Hello, world!”。
除了加号运算符,还可以使用字符串的concat() 方法。这个方法允许将一个或多个字符串连接到调用它的字符串末尾。语法如下:str1.concat(str2, str3,...) 。这里的str1是要被连接的基础字符串,str2、str3等是要连接到str1末尾的字符串。示例代码如下:
let str1 = "JavaScript ";
let str2 = "is ";
let str3 = "amazing!";
let result = str1.concat(str2, str3);
console.log(result);
上述代码运行后,会在控制台输出 “JavaScript is amazing!”。
另外,在ES6中引入的模板字面量也能实现字符串连接功能。模板字面量使用反引号(`)包裹字符串,在其中可以嵌入表达式。通过这种方式实现字符串连接,代码可读性更高。示例如下:
let str1 = "This ";
let str2 = "is ";
let str3 = "a great example.";
let combined = `${str1}${str2}${str3}`;
console.log(combined);
执行上述代码,控制台会输出 “This is a great example.”。
掌握这些在JavaScript中连接字符串的方法,能让开发者在处理字符串相关任务时更加得心应手,无论是简单的文本拼接,还是复杂的字符串操作逻辑,都能高效地实现。根据具体的编程场景和需求,选择最合适的方法,能提升代码的质量和开发效率。
- 别再依赖 Swagger,试试这几个在线文档生成神器
- MyBatisPlus 助力提升生产力讲解
- 剖析交付工作中四个段位的一个案例
- SpringBoot 健康检查与容器的协作之道
- JavaScript 中 Eval 函数的历史与现状:执行代码字符串
- K8s 弃用 Docker 无需惊慌
- Java 中数组下标、遍历与最值全解析
- OPPO 为杭州梦马运动健康保驾护航
- 18 个 JavaScript 新手必知技巧
- JavaScript 数组 reduce 用法太难?这 5 个例子助你轻松掌握!
- 美国摇滚巨星耗时五年自学成为程序员
- 你知晓 DevOps 的自动化架构 GitOps 吗?
- 解决问题能力重于技术本身
- AMD Zen 3 获 GCC 11 编译器初步支持
- 中国首次达成量子优越性,Science 审稿人难安